Dreaming of Him

He is beautiful,
I scold myself inwardly to his intoxicating eyes.
Is there no way out of his dreamy musical embrace?
His familiar smile rests on the morning sunrise.
Believing there is nothing compared to his beauty.
He is manly beautiful.

I can’t understand why he makes my heart beat so fast,
Flying by my own wings yet still on my feet.
So incredibly beautiful, his moonlight appearance. 
Gazing upon his heavenly firm beauty underneath the storm.
God must have crafted him special.
Locked up in his amazing beauty, he is manly beautiful.

I turn my eyes towards his stardust smile, his brown eyes
His words charmed my heart to her beat,
Submitting like a servant to her master on authority
Overwhelmed by his melodious voice,
Thunderous yet gentle like a baby smile.
A master piece, he is manly beautiful.

What Made Sense Today

I walked by early in the eyes of my beloved.
Staring at his arms wide open to receive today.
Another day in my head, exhausted to think just watch.
Him resting on the beautiful grass at the summer tent
Looking so hopeful of what made sense at that moment,
On my end knowing at twilight I needed survival.
Wishing his sense of hope with give me a wet kiss to awaken mine.

Ssh! My thoughts, let me navigate along his smile to net out the hope.
I wonder what he is thinking! Raising my head a mile, into his dreams,
To see into his dreams, no space between reality and what is to become.
Where everything was created by his image, yet real to my eyes.
I move closer, near his chest to locate his undying heartbeat lived.
Dear God, Let me see what makes sense by him

History In Seconds

I  cant say I love you without having beautiful chords in my ears.
I have a story to tell about your beautiful  heart  for years.
You nurture my flesh and bones like a piece of art,
Painting your sunshine within the rainbow inside my heart.
What  a history I have with you  my love.

How I know you now is,how I wanted to spend the rest of my life,
My vows that  paints a picture of your nature in my eyes.
I wouldn't have it any less than these , my wife.
Growing beneath your embrace, comforting in these strife.
History written in Heaven, my love.

Numbers can’t compare with how many times I stared into you.
Counting the fallen leaves just to find the right musical words,
To tell you how beautiful you are, no one else can compare.
No wealth can compare with the worth that’s inside you.
This kind of love chords is a history to tell, My love.
